Elaines Mesquite Smoked Turkey
From chefelaine 16 years agoIngredients
- 1 fair-sized turkey breast shopping list
- 4 turkey wings shopping list
- salt to taste, preferably coarse salt shopping list
- aluminum foil to make smoke pouch shopping list
- Mesquite wood chips shopping list
How to make it
- To make the smoke pouch:
- lay out one long piece of tinfoil
- to this, top with dry mesquite wood chips
- Add a little water to create steam and help it to smoke
- Cover this with another sheet of foil
- Fold up the foil on all four sides to create a pouch
- Puncture the pouch about 8 places on both sides

- oil the grill
- Salt the turkey pieces
- Light the grill as follows:
- Left burner, HIGH
- On this side, set the pouch
- Middle burner OFF
- Here, place the turkey pieces
- Right burner, HIGH for first 25 minutes, then turn to MEDIUM flame
- Close the lid, and let the smoke pouch permeate the meat
- Allow the turkey to rest, tented in foil, for at least 15 minutes before carving
- Served with cole slaw, steamed or grilled celery, carrot and asparagus, this makes a main you will want to make often!
